How did the authors of the constitution hope the House of Representatives and senate would balance each other
katovenus [111]

Answer:

By the system of self-checking.

Explanation:

Balance in U.S. constitution is all about the Separation of Powers, how the power is shared between the branches and how it can be challenged by one branch on one another.

The Legislature branch is a bicameral system, that combined the ideas that each state should have equal representation in the federal government (Senate) and representatives that were based on population number (House of representatives).

To guarantee the balance of House of Representatives and Senate a system of self-checking was created that includes:

   * Bills must be passed by both houses of Congress;

   * House must originate revenue bills;

   * Neither house may adjourn for more than three days without the consent of the other house;

   * All journals are to be published.

Which of the fWhich of the following best explains how settlers in Texas adapted the land for farming? (TEK 7.9A) * 2 points The
posledela

Answer:

They grazed cattle to make the land ready for farming

Explanation:

Texas is a very large state (the second largest in the U.S. after Alaska), and it has different climates and biomes. In general terms, the East is wetter and more suitable for farming, while the West is dry and more suitable for cattle.

In east and central texas, settlers would use cattle to graze the land, and make it suitable for farming, and depending on how east or west of the state they were, they also used irrigation systems to make the land more suitable for growing crops.
